- Specialising in Biotechnology or Forensic and Pathology Testing

- From 2012 direct entry to second year in defined based degree(s) at Swinburne (Guaranteed Entry Scheme)

- Currently these courses typically provide up to one year credit into certain degrees programs (Pathways Direct – subject to meeting academic requirements)

Further study - Diploma of Laboratory Technology

Page 7: 2011 Open Day Sciences Pathways presentations

Swinburne

7

Science at TAFE

- 2-year competency-based training

- 3 streams covers the following subject areas- Biological chemistry- Biotechnology - Histology- Quality analysis- Pathology testing- Laboratory computing- Forensic testing

- Molecular Biology- Physiology- Occupational Health &

Safety - Microbiology - Tissue culture

Diploma of Laboratory Technology

- For students requiring basic sciences competencies- Entry level laboratory workplace jobs or re-training

- 1.5 semesters- 5 core units

- Communications, Data, OH&S, Quality, Organisation- 7 electives

- Including Prepare working solutions, Perform aseptic techniques

- Leads to entry to TAFE or some university courses(eg. Cert IV Lab Techniques)

Certificate III in Laboratory Skills

Page 10: 2011 Open Day Sciences Pathways presentations

SwinburneScience at TAFE

- For students who require science/maths/physics prerequisites for further study

- 1 year- Basics in chemistry, physics, maths, biology, computing

and study skills- Leads to entry to TAFE or university courses

Certificate III / IV in Science
